Default RAAF's F-111's free to good home

The Australian Minister for Defence was just on the radio announcing that the RAAF is looking for places to preserve seven of our F-111's. We retired them last year after operating the type for over 40 years.

We've 'replaced' them with Super Hornets (can anything really replace a Hog!!!)

Basically the conditions are that you need an enclosed facility to display them to the public and need to remove any asbestos

Unfortunately they are going to demilitarise them before handover but they will pay for reasonable transport costs.
